Glendalough Peated Pot Still is a bold fusion between Irish whiskey tradition and innovation, redefining the Pot Still style. It is made from malted and unmalted barley, distilled in traditional copper pot stills, and aged for over seven years. The introduction of peated malt, smoked during drying, adds a bold twist, blending delicate smoke with the characteristic spices and creamy texture of Pot Still whiskey. Crafted and bottled at 46% ABV, it begins its maturation in ex-bourbon American oak casks. It then spends an additional four years in virgin oak casks. This long aging process imparts notes of toasted oak, rich vanilla, and warm spices, perfectly balanced by a subtle peated smoke. A very special edition, available for a limited time only.

Zaya is a premium, dark aged rum sourced from the islands of the Caribbean. Purposely crafted with a blend of aged rums, to achieve a seductive nose of baked fruit and spiced vanilla and a smooth palate of caramel and toasted oak. Deep amber in color, the finish is profound and touched with just a hint of smoke.
